What digital quotes for corporations are and how they work

Digital quotes for corporations are electronic documents that present pricing, terms, and scope for goods or services, streamlined for secure review and approval. They combine templated content, variable pricing fields, and electronic signature capabilities to shorten sales cycles and reduce manual errors. For U.S. organizations, these workflows typically rely on eSignature platforms that adhere to ESIGN and UETA requirements to ensure enforceability. When integrated with CRM and document storage, digital quotes can be version-controlled, auditable, and retained according to corporate records retention policies.

Common obstacles in moving to digital quotes

  • Legacy processes and paper-based approvals slow response times and create version confusion.
  • Inconsistent quote templates lead to pricing errors and contractual ambiguity across teams.
  • Integration gaps between CRM, CPQ, and storage cause manual re-entry and duplication.
  • Security and compliance requirements add complexity to vendor selection and deployment.

Representative user roles and responsibilities

Sales Manager

A Sales Manager configures templated quote documents, sets approval thresholds, and monitors signature completion. They use digital quotes to reduce negotiation time and keep pricing consistent across accounts while ensuring required approvals are captured.

Procurement Lead

A Procurement Lead reviews supplier quotes for compliance, verifies contract clauses, and ensures records retention. They rely on secure transmission, audit trails, and access controls when accepting or countering digital vendor quotes.

Core features that support corporate digital quotes

Several platform features directly improve accuracy, compliance, and speed for enterprise quotes and approvals.

Templates

Reusable, centrally managed templates ensure consistent terms and formatting for corporate quotes, reducing manual edits and supporting compliance with company-approved language across teams and geographies.

Bulk Send

Bulk Send enables simultaneous distribution of identical quotes to multiple recipients, with individualized tracking and separate audit records for each recipient to speed mass renewals or standard offers.

Conditional Fields

Conditional Fields display or hide pricing and clause options based on selections, which simplifies complex offers and ensures only applicable terms appear in the final quote.

Audit Trail

A built-in Audit Trail records timestamps, IP addresses, and signer actions to provide an immutable history for compliance, dispute resolution, and internal reporting.

Best practices for secure and accurate digital quotes

Follow standardized processes and controls to maintain consistency, legal validity, and efficient approvals for corporate quotes.

Maintain centrally managed templates and version control
Store approved templates in a central repository, track versions, and restrict edit permissions to legal or designated administrators to prevent unvetted language in customer-facing quotes.
Use role-based approvals tied to pricing thresholds
Implement automated approval routing based on discount or contract value, ensuring appropriate review by finance or legal before offers are sent to customers.
Apply consistent authentication and identity verification
Require appropriate signer authentication for high-value or regulated transactions, and document the selected method in the audit trail for compliance and dispute mitigation.
Integrate with CRM and document storage for traceability
Connect quote workflows to opportunity records and long-term storage to maintain a single source of truth, simplify revenue recognition, and support retention policies.
